CMU’s Chemistry PhD empowers synthetic, physical, and computational chemists to tackle challenges from green energy to precision medicine. Students automate reaction discovery with robotic microfluidics, visualize catalytic intermediates via ultrafast spectroscopy, and deploy ML retrosynthesis planners that accelerate drug pipelines. Entrepreneurial seed funds and IP workshops support translation to cleantech and pharma startups.
